Summary
As he turns 40, Barlowe Reed, who is black, moves to buy the home he's long rented in Atlanta's Old Fourth Ward, the birthplace of Martin Luther King Jr. His timing is bad: whites have taken note of the cheap, rehab-ready houses in the historically black neighborhood and, as Barlowe's neighbor says to him, They comin. Skyrocketing housing prices and the new neighbors' haste anger Barlowe, whose 20-something nephew is staying with him, and other longtime residents, who feel invaded and threatened
